User Flow Diagram Maker

Map every step of your user journey — instantly.

Turn complex processes into clear, visual flowcharts. Describe your user flow and our AI builds the diagram in seconds.

Free to use — no sign-up required

Everything You Need to Map User Flows

Purpose-built flowchart tools for product, UX, and engineering teams.

🤖

AI Flow Generation

Describe your process in plain English and get a fully structured user flow diagram with nodes and connections in seconds.

🖱️

Drag-and-Drop Nodes

Click and drag any node to reposition it. Rearrange your entire user flow without redrawing connections.

🔀

Decision Branching

Add decision nodes with Yes/No branches to accurately model conditional paths in your user journey.

Auto Layout

One click arranges all nodes cleanly in top-to-bottom, left-to-right, or any direction you choose.

🎨

Custom Colors

Color-code start, process, decision, and end nodes independently to make your flow instantly scannable.

👁️

Instant Preview

Every change you make — label edits, new connections, layout shifts — renders live in the preview panel.

Multiple Ways to Build Your Flow

💬

Describe It

Type your user journey in plain language and let AI generate the flowchart structure automatically.

✏️

Add Nodes Manually

Use the node editor to add start, process, decision, and end steps exactly where you need them.

📋

Paste Your Steps

Copy a list of process steps from a doc or spreadsheet and map them into a flowchart instantly.

📁

Upload Data (Pro)

Import CSV or Excel files with structured process data to auto-populate your user flow diagram.

Share Your User Flow Anywhere

⬇️

Download as Image

Export your user flow diagram as a high-resolution PNG or SVG for presentations, docs, and handoffs.

🔗

Share a Link

Send a direct link to your flowchart so teammates and stakeholders can view it instantly.

🌐

Embed on Your Site

Drop an embed code into your website, wiki, or product docs to keep flows always accessible.

📊

Add to Slides

Copy the image into PowerPoint, Google Slides, or Notion to enrich your presentations.

About MakeCharts User Flow Diagram Maker

MakeCharts is a free online chart and diagram tool built for speed and clarity. The user flow diagram maker is purpose-built for teams who need to visualize processes fast. No installs, no steep learning curves — just describe your flow and see it rendered instantly.

  • AI-powered flowchart generation from plain-language descriptions
  • Drag-and-drop node editor with Start, Process, Decision, and End types
  • Auto-layout engine for instant clean arrangement
  • Export to PNG and SVG with no watermarks on free plans
  • Embed codes and shareable links for easy distribution
  • Part of a 50+ chart type platform used by teams worldwide

By the Numbers

Time to first flowchart
<2 min
Chart styles available
50+
Node types supported
4
Languages supported
12+
Free to start
100%

How to Make a User Flow Diagram

From blank canvas to shareable diagram in three simple steps.

1

Describe or Add Your Steps

Type your user journey into the AI prompt or manually add nodes using the node editor. Choose from Start, Process, Decision, and End types.

e.g. 'User visits landing page → clicks sign up → fills form → confirms email → reaches dashboard'

2

Connect and Customize

Link nodes with directional arrows, add labels to connections, and apply colors to each node type. Use auto-layout to tidy everything instantly.

Add a 'Password Forgotten?' decision node branching to a reset flow and back to login.

3

Export and Share

Download your user flow diagram as PNG or SVG, copy a shareable link, or embed it directly into your product docs or website.

Export to PNG and paste into your Figma handoff doc or Confluence page.

Who Uses User Flow Diagram Maker

Flowcharts that serve every team, project, and process.

Product & UX

Map User Journeys Before You Build

Visualize every path a user can take through your product before a single line of code is written. Spot friction points early and align the team on intended flows.

Onboarding flow diagrams
Checkout and payment flows
Feature navigation maps
Error-state user paths
Mobile app screen flows
Engineering & DevOps

Document System and Process Logic

Turn complex system logic and branching conditions into clear flowcharts that developers and QA teams can follow without ambiguity.

API request handling flows
Authentication logic diagrams
CI/CD pipeline visualizations
Data processing workflows
Error-handling decision trees
Business & Operations

Streamline Operational Workflows

Map approval processes, support escalations, and operational procedures so every team member knows exactly what to do at each step.

Customer support escalation flows
Employee onboarding checklists
Sales qualification processes
Invoice approval workflows
Incident response diagrams
Education & Training

Teach Processes with Visual Clarity

Replace dense procedure manuals with clean flowcharts that learners can follow step by step, including decision branches for different scenarios.

Lab procedure flow diagrams
Student registration processes
Course selection decision trees
Research methodology flows
Safety protocol diagrams

AI Flowchart Maker vs. Traditional Tools

See why teams switch from legacy diagramming tools to MakeCharts.

Traditional Diagramming Tools

  • Hours spent manually placing and connecting nodes
  • Steep learning curve for new users
  • Expensive licenses or per-seat fees
  • No AI assistance — every change is manual
  • Export formats locked behind paywalls
  • Hard to share or embed without extra steps

MakeCharts User Flow Diagram Maker

  • AI generates a full flowchart from a text description in seconds
  • Intuitive drag-and-drop interface — no training needed
  • Free to start, affordable plans for power users
  • Auto-layout and smart node placement built in
  • One-click PNG, SVG export and shareable links
  • Embed-ready code for wikis, docs, and websites

Frequently Asked Questions

What is a user flow diagram?

A user flow diagram is a visual map showing the steps a user takes through a product, service, or process — from entry point to goal completion. It uses nodes (shapes) to represent actions and decisions, connected by arrows showing the path. Teams use them to design, communicate, and improve user experiences.

How do I make a user flow diagram with this tool?

Open the User Flow Diagram Maker, type a description of your process into the AI prompt, and click generate. The AI creates a flowchart with Start, Process, Decision, and End nodes automatically. You can then drag nodes to reposition them, add or remove connections, change colors, and export the result — all without leaving the page.

Is this user flow diagram maker really free?

Yes. The core flowchart maker is completely free with no sign-up required. You can create, customize, and download user flow diagrams at no cost. Paid plans unlock more AI credits, CSV/file uploads, embed codes, and priority support for teams with higher volume needs.

Can I make a flowchart with decision branches?

Absolutely. The tool includes a dedicated Decision node type. Add a decision node anywhere in your flow, then create two connections from it — label one 'Yes' and one 'No' — to branch your user flow into separate paths. This is ideal for login flows, checkout logic, eligibility checks, and any conditional process.

What is the difference between a user flow and a flowchart?

A flowchart is the general diagram format using nodes and arrows to represent a process. A user flow diagram is a specific type of flowchart focused on the steps a user takes within a product or service. MakeCharts supports both: you can create general process flowcharts or user-specific journey maps using the same tool.

Built for Every Team

  • No design or diagramming experience required — the AI handles structure for you
  • Works on any device: desktop, tablet, or mobile browser
  • Available in 12+ languages so global teams can collaborate
  • Simple enough for first-time users, flexible enough for power users
  • Free tier gives full access to flowchart creation with no credit card needed
  • Keyboard-accessible controls and clean interface for all skill levels

Your Diagrams Stay Yours

  • Your flowchart data is used only to render your chart — not shared or sold
  • No account required to create and download a user flow diagram
  • Diagrams you create are under your control to share, download, or delete
  • We do not use your content to train AI models without consent
  • You can delete your account and all associated data at any time
  • Transparent data practices — no hidden data collection

Start Mapping User Flows Now

Free, fast, and AI-powered. Your first flowchart is ready in under two minutes.

No sign-up required
AI generates your first flow instantly
Free PNG and SVG export
Decision branches and auto-layout included
Works on any device